具備したことを特徴とする電子式水深計。[Scope of Claim for Utility Model Registration] Water depth detection means for detecting water depth; Diving time measuring means for starting timekeeping and measuring diving time when diving starts; and detecting when the water depth has fallen below a specific value. It is characterized by comprising: a detection means; and a stop means for stopping the timekeeping operation of the diving time measuring means when the detection means detects that the water depth has become below a specific value for a predetermined period of time. Electronic depth gauge.
